The story beings with Iru Kim, when she was a kid her mother used to work as a maid, it was the largest house in their neighborhood. An old grandma lived there by herself and his grandson Hayul Gwon. Both Iru and Hayul met each other in the hallway and at the first glance Hayul took interest in Iru.
Hayul wanted to play with her and at beginning he used to treat her nicely and gave her many gifts but sometimes he used to get mad at her and tear apart the dolls. He was way too obsessed with Iru. This made Iru uncomfortable, she could not bear it anymore so she stopped visiting the house.
One day Hayul met Iru on the street and he threatened her to come back and play with him otherwise he will frame Iru's mother for thefting. This made Iru feel terrified, she kept living her life in fear and wished Hayul to disappear from her life.
Suddenly after some time he died. Back in the present Iru at her university, there she found her classmates discussing about a new guy coming back to the class and his name is Ha-im Yu.
Later on when she was walking to the stairs and saw a guy and felt shocked as he looked similar to Hayul, but he was dead 13 years. She found out his name is Ha-im and still feels uneasy around him because he looks similar.
On the other hand there's another guy called Ji-an who is a friend to Iru since school life and he suddenly came back. He was the crush of Iru but he rejected her. Meanwhile there was a rumor that Iru is cursed and whoever liked Iru in the school life they would face death or consequences for showing interest in her.
The similar events started to happen again in the present time when another guy of her class tried to flirt with her. This made Iru feeling disturbed as she fears this is the curse of Hayul.
